WebWomen with an ectopic pregnancy may have irregular bleeding and pelvic or belly (abdominal) pain. The pain is often just on one side. Symptoms often appear 6 to 8 weeks after the last normal menstrual period. If the ectopic pregnancy is not in the fallopian tube, symptoms may happen later. WebDec 9, 2024 · [2, 3, 4] The incidence of ectopic pregnancy is 1-2% and is still the most common cause of pregnancy-related death in the first trimester, accounting for about 10% of all pregnancy-related deaths. Missed ectopic pregnancy is a leading cause of emergency medicine malpractice claims. [5, 6, 7, 8]
